Markus the Gorilla Bank

Markus the Gorilla Bank

Being too old for a piggy bank doesn’t mean you just stop collecting your change. Plastic might be the payment method of choice now, but cash is still king. You’re bound to end up with change eventually, so you might as well have a conversation piece to store it in. Like Markus. At 7.5” x 7” x 7.5″ he’s not going to be holding a college fund, but there’s definitely room in his silver or black ceramic body to hold enough couch money to pay for a quality sixer. Pennies saved have never looked this good.
